Effects of Distinct n-6 to n-3 Polyunsaturated Fatty Acid Rations on Insulin Resistant and AD-like Phenotypes in High-Fat Diets-Fed APP/PS1 Transgenic Mice

<title>Abstract</title> <p><bold>Background: </bold>Type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M) and Alzheimer’s disease (AD) are two prevalent diseases with comparable pathophysiological features and genetic predisposition.<bold> </bold>Polyunsaturated fatty acids (PUFAs) are essential in maintaining normal brain function.
